1. Understanding the SQA Higher Accounting Course | 了解 SQA Higher 会计课程

The SQA Higher Accounting course is built around two equally weighted units: Financial Accounting and Management Accounting. In Financial Accounting, you learn to prepare, analyse and interpret financial statements for different types of business organisations, applying accounting concepts and regulatory frameworks. The Management Accounting unit focuses on internal decision-making, covering costing, budgeting, variance analysis and the use of information technology to support planning and control. The course is designed to develop your ability to solve problems, think logically and communicate financial information clearly. External assessment consists of a single question paper lasting 2 hours and 30 minutes, worth 100 marks, which tests both units through a mixture of structured and extended-response tasks.

The course assumes prior attainment at National 5 level, but many concepts are revisited in greater depth and with new complexities, such as incomplete records, manufacturing accounts and interpretation using ratio analysis. Teachers deliver the course through a blend of theory lessons, practical ledger work and spreadsheet-based tasks. To succeed, you must move beyond simple bookkeeping and begin to think like an accountant who advises management or external stakeholders.

2. Key Differences from National 5 Accounting | 与 National 5 会计的主要区别

One of the most noticeable changes at Higher is the depth of analysis required. At National 5, you often follow prescribed formats to complete ledger accounts or simple financial statements. Higher demands interpretation and evaluation: you might be asked to explain why a liquidity ratio has worsened, or to suggest improvements based on a variance report. The shift from ‘doing’ to ‘thinking’ is substantial, and the marking scheme rewards insight as much as accuracy.

Another difference lies in the volume and range of technical content. You will encounter manufacturing accounts, departmental accounts, partnership appropriation statements, and more sophisticated inventory valuation methods such as AVCO. The management accounting section introduces concepts like overhead absorption rates, break-even for multi-product settings, and detailed cash budgeting with supporting schedules for trade receivables and payables. Spreadsheet competency becomes explicitly assessed; you are expected to design, format and use formulae to build working financial models—not merely enter numbers into pre-made templates.

3. Essential Prerequisite Knowledge | 必备前置知识

Although the Higher course is designed to follow on from National 5, students come with varying degrees of confidence in the double-entry system. You should be completely comfortable with the classification of accounts (assets, liabilities, capital, income and expenses), the rules of debit and credit, and the preparation of a trial balance. If you still hesitate when deciding whether to debit or credit an electricity bill, revisit the fundamental accounting equation: Assets = Liabilities + Equity. Everything else flows from that relationship.

In addition to double-entry, a strong grasp of the extended trial balance and adjustments for accruals, prepayments, depreciation and irrecoverable debts will save a huge amount of time. These adjustments underpin the preparation of income statements and statements of financial position, and they are tested in almost every Higher exam paper. Make summary cards for each type of adjustment showing the journal entry and the impact on profit and net assets.

4. Financial Accounting: Core Concepts and Techniques | 财务会计:核心概念与方法

Financial accounting at Higher level requires you to prepare full sets of financial statements for sole traders, partnerships, companies and not-for-profit organisations. You must apply the relevant accounting concepts—going concern, accruals, prudence, consistency and materiality—and be able to justify your treatment of various items. For example, when a business changes its depreciation method, you should discuss whether this enhances or reduces comparability and why consistency is still maintained through disclosure.

The partnership unit introduces appropriation accounts, where profits are shared after accounting for interest on capital, interest on drawings and partners’ salaries. You need to understand the differences between the statement of financial position of a partnership and that of a sole trader, particularly the capital and current accounts. Company accounts include the treatment of share capital, debentures, reserves and dividend proposals, all of which require careful reading of the question notes to apply the correct disclosure.

5. Management Accounting: Decision-Making Skills | 管理会计:决策技能

Management accounting shifts the focus from reporting the past to shaping the future. You will learn to classify costs by behaviour (fixed, variable, semi-variable and stepped), build break-even charts, and calculate contribution per unit and margin of safety. A key Higher skill is the ability to advise management on special order decisions, product discontinuation or limiting factor analysis—always using relevant costs and the contribution approach, never total absorption cost where it would mislead.

Overhead allocation, apportionment and absorption are central to Higher management accounting. You will be expected to complete a multi-step calculation: first allocate and apportion overheads to cost centres, then re-apportion service centre costs, and finally calculate an overhead absorption rate (OAR) using a suitable basis such as labour hours or machine hours. The formula is straightforward but the exam often embeds it within a larger problem, testing your ability to stay organised under time pressure.

6. Mastering Double-Entry and Ledger Accounts | 掌握复式记账与分类账

At Higher, ledger accounts are no longer just a mechanical exercise; they form the engine that drives the financial statements. You must be fluent in preparing ledger accounts for non-current assets (including disposal), for inventory using both FIFO and AVCO methods, and for control accounts that reconcile with individual debtor and creditor ledgers. Each transaction must be linked to its source document, and you should be able to trace how an entry in the purchases ledger control account affects both the income statement and the statement of financial position.

Bank reconciliation statements and control account reconciliations appear regularly and are often combined with adjustments. A typical Higher question presents a cash book balance, a bank statement balance, a list of outstanding cheques and lodgements, plus perhaps a bank error. Your task is to update the cash book first, then prepare the reconciliation. Resist the temptation to start with the statement; always adjust the business’s own record first, because the statement reflects the bank’s perspective, which may contain items unknown to the entity.

7. Ratio Analysis and Interpretation | 比率分析与解读

Ratio analysis is one of the most heavily-weighted areas in the Higher exam, and it demands both calculation and commentary. You will need to compute profitability ratios (gross profit margin, net profit margin, ROCE), liquidity ratios (current ratio, acid test), efficiency ratios (trade payable days, inventory turnover) and investment ratios (earnings per share, price earnings ratio). The formulas must be memorised exactly, and you should be able to manipulate them when given one missing component.

比率分析是 Higher 考试中权重最高的领域之一,要求进行计算并附有评论。你需要计算盈利能力比率(毛利率、净利润率、已用资本回报率)、流动性比率(流动比率、速动比率)、效率比率(应付账款周转天数、存货周转率)和投资比率(每股收益、市盈率)。公式必须准确记忆,当题目给出一个缺失环节时,你应能对公式进行变形处理。

Gross Profit Margin = (Gross Profit ÷ Sales Revenue) × 100

Interpretation goes far beyond stating whether a ratio is ‘good’ or ‘bad’. You must link movements to business events: a falling current ratio might be explained by a large purchase of non-current assets using cash, while an improving ROCE could signal better utilisation of borrowed funds even if profit dipped due to one-off costs. Always compare with previous periods and industry averages where data is provided. The exam frequently presents a scenario with two years of financial statements and asks you to write an evaluative report for a stakeholder group such as shareholders, lenders or potential investors.

8. Budgeting and Variance Analysis | 预算编制与差异分析

Budgets are not merely forecasts—they are planning and control tools. The Higher course covers the preparation of cash budgets, sales budgets, production budgets and master budgets. You need to calculate receipts from trade receivables using given credit terms and collect payments in the correct month, while also slotting in capital expenditure and loan repayments. A pro-forma layout is essential; set up columns for each month and a total column, and double-check your brought-forward and carried-forward balances.

Variance analysis takes budgeting one step further. You compare actual performance against flexed budget to isolate the effects of volume changes from true cost or revenue variances. Key variances include sales price variance, sales volume variance, and for costs, you may calculate material price, material usage, labour rate and labour efficiency variances. When commenting, explain who might be responsible—the purchasing manager for an adverse material price variance due to supplier shortages, or the production manager for an adverse labour efficiency variance caused by machine breakdowns. Remember: adverse variances waste resources; favourable variances may indicate genuine efficiency but could also point to under-budgeting or quality compromise.

9. ICT and Spreadsheet Skills in Accounting | 会计中的信息与通信技术及电子表格技能

SQA Higher Accounting explicitly assesses your ability to use spreadsheet software to solve accounting problems. In the assignment and the question paper, you may be asked to create or work with spreadsheets that contain embedded formulae, IF statements, conditional formatting and lookups. You must understand absolute and relative cell referencing—when a formula is copied across columns, a reference like $B$5 will remain fixed while B5 will adjust. This distinction is frequently tested in tasks requiring you to model inventory costs or loan amortisation schedules.

Beyond formula construction, you should be comfortable presenting data in chart form—bar charts for budget comparisons, line graphs for trend analysis, and pie charts for cost structure. Always label axes, include a clear title and ensure the chart conveys a specific insight, not just decoration. The assignment component of the course gives you the opportunity to design a complete spreadsheet solution, so practise building templates with data validation, protection on formula cells and drop-down lists to minimise input errors.

10. Exam Technique and Time Management | 考试技巧与时间管理

The Higher Accounting question paper rewards precision and clear logical steps. There are 100 marks to earn in 150 minutes, which gives roughly 1.5 minutes per mark. However, many students fall into the trap of spending too long on early, high-tariff financial statements and then rushing the interpretation sections. A disciplined approach is essential: allocate time according to mark weighting, and if you are stuck on a balancing figure, leave it, note the discrepancy, and move on. You can return with a clearer head and pick up method marks for the subsequent parts.

Another proven strategy is to read the entire paper before putting pen to paper. Identify the parts where your strengths lie and tackle those first to build confidence. When writing evaluative comments, use the structure: identify the ratio, state the change, suggest a reason and link it back to the stakeholder’s concern. Marker comments consistently note that weak candidates describe ratios while strong candidates analyse them and recommend actions. Practice with past papers under timed conditions and always self-assess against the marking schemes published on the SQA website.

11. Progression Pathways: From Higher to Advanced Higher and Beyond | 进阶路径:从 Higher 到 Advanced Higher 及更远

A strong performance in Higher Accounting opens clear pathways to Advanced Higher Accounting, which deepens your knowledge of financial reporting standards, cash flow statements and management accounting techniques such as transfer pricing and balanced scorecards. This qualification is highly valued by universities for entry into accounting, finance, business and law degrees. If you are considering a professional qualification such as ACCA or ICAS, the Higher course gives you a solid head-start, covering many of the fundamental principles examined at the early stages of those programmes.

12. Recommended Resources and Study Habits | 推荐资源与学习习惯

Your core resource is the SQA Higher Accounting specification and the associated specimen question paper, both freely available on the SQA website. Print them and keep them close—the specification lists every learning outcome, and the specimen paper shows the exact command words used by examiners. Supplement these with a good textbook, such as ‘Higher Accounting for SQA’ by Leckie & Leckie, which provides worked examples and graded exercises. Create a digital or paper glossary of key terms: define ‘overhead absorption’, ‘relevant cost’, ‘preference share capital’ and other terms in your own words.

Effective study habits are just as important as resources. Schedule short, frequent revision sessions rather than cramming; 30 minutes of daily ledger practice will outperform a four-hour marathon the night before a test. Form a study group where each member takes responsibility for a topic and teaches it to the others—explaining why the double-entry for a bonus issue works builds deeper understanding than simply memorising the journal. Finally, maintain a reflective error log: every time you make a mistake in a practice question, write down what went wrong and how you will avoid it next time. Over a year, this log becomes your personal improvement plan and a powerful revision tool.
